The official music video is pure unadulterated energy, featuring fast-paced editing and Speed’s unpredictable movements that match the "hype-driven" style of his livestreams.
The song famously samples Ray Charles ’s "Hit the Road Jack" and The Fugees ’ "Ready or Not". Its repetitive hook— "shake that ass, bounce that ass" —interspersed with Speed’s "Arf! Arf!" barks, made it an instant meme sensation on TikTok .
